I have a 2005 115 4 stroke with 3200 hours on it. At 1000 rpms or higher it sounds and runs great with no problems. when i cut the engine to idle it either dies or gets really close. occasionally it will sound better and hold a higher rpm and sound fine but it will return to the low idle and stall out. Carbon build up?

most likely your iac valve is not doing its job right.
IAC = Idle Air Control valve.
the ECM with input of sensors makes the iac valve open or close more or less as needed.
